Interface IUpdatable
Interface utilisée pour insérer ou mettre à jour une ressource par la méthode HTTP POST.
Espace de noms : System.Data.Services
Assembly : Microsoft.Data.Services (en Microsoft.Data.Services.dll)
Syntaxe
'Déclaration
Public Interface IUpdatable
'Utilisation
Dim instance As IUpdatable
public interface IUpdatable
public interface class IUpdatable
type IUpdatable = interface end
public interface IUpdatable
Le type IUpdatable expose les membres suivants.
Méthodes
Nom | Description | |
---|---|---|
AddReferenceToCollection | Ajoute la valeur spécifiée à la collection. | |
ClearChanges | Annule une modification aux données. | |
CreateResource | Crée la ressource du type spécifié et qui appartient au conteneur spécifié. | |
DeleteResource | Supprime la ressource spécifiée. | |
GetResource | Obtient la ressource du type spécifié, identifié par un nom de requête et un nom de type. | |
GetValue | Obtient la valeur de la propriété spécifiée pour l'objet cible. | |
RemoveReferenceFromCollection | Supprime la valeur spécifiée de la collection. | |
ResetResource | Restaure la ressource identifiée par le paramètre resource à sa valeur par défaut. | |
ResolveResource | Retourne l'instance de la ressource représentée par l'objet de ressource spécifié. | |
SaveChanges | Enregistre toutes les modifications qui ont été apportées à l'aide des API IUpdatable. | |
SetReference | Définit la valeur de la propriété de référence spécifiée sur l'objet cible. | |
SetValue | Définit la valeur de la propriété avec le nom spécifié sur la ressource cible sur la valeur de propriété spécifiée. |
Haut de la page
Notes
L'interface IUpdatable est indépendante des ressources. Les méthodes qui retournent des objets représentant des ressources peuvent retourner n'importe quel élément.
L'objet retourné est un objet opaque qui représente la ressource. Pour utiliser la référence pour lire ou mettre à jour une valeur, le même objet opaque est retransmis à IUpdatable.
L'implémentation de IUpdatable doit suivre le mappage de cet objet opaque à l'objet qu'il représente. Lorsque la ressource est sérialisée et qu'une instance CLR (Common Langage Runtime) du type correct est nécessaire, la méthode ResolveResource sur IUpdatable est appelée avec l'objet opaque.
Pour sérialiser l'objet, appelez la méthode ResolveResource sur IUpdatable.